Description

As other extensions are starting to support Dev Containers it would be helpful to have a way for them to disable the "reopen in container" parts of the Dev Containers UI while keeping the devcontainer.json editing support.

This could be done using a machine-scoped setting, e.g., for the case where Remote-SSH is used to connect to a dev container that was created using the Dev Container CLI.

Another option would be to use a marker inside the container, that might be more automatic than a machine-scope setting that has to be placed.
